2012-03-28 7 views
1

이 문제에 대한 해결책을 찾기 위해 지난 2 일간 검색했습니다.파일 업로드를 위해 IE에서 Jquery Malsup Form 플러그인 오류가 발생했습니다.

jquery 용 Malsup 양식 플러그인의 파일 업로드와 관련하여 .click() 기능을 주로 사용합니다. 그러나 나는 그걸 처리 할 수 ​​있었지만 지금은 진행률 표시 줄을 구현하려고합니다.

Chrome/FF에서는 잘 작동하지만 IE에서는 이전과 같은 오류가 발생합니다. 기본적으로 플러그인은 forms.submit() 부분에 달라 붙습니다.

IE에서 데모 페이지를로드 해보고 문제를 파악할 수 있습니까? http://jquery.malsup.com/form/progress.html

가 나는 bar.width (percentVal) 후 2 세미콜론 (2 개 개의 다른 위치) 실종됐다 발견하지만, 심지어 그들과 함께 작동하지 않습니다에.

IE 개발자 도구를 사용하여 데모 페이지를 실행하는 경우, 양식의 ismit() 부분에서 멈 춥니 다. 당신이를 사용하지 않는 경우, 나는이 같은 문제를 가진이

감사합니다 .....

답변

1

를 진행 표시 줄이 애니메이션을하지 않고 파일은 파일의 이름을 반환 이후 업로드 보인다 IE. 일부 인터넷 검색을 한 후 업로드 진행률이 이고 XHR 업로드가 Chrome, FF, Safari 및 IE10에서만 지원된다는 사실을 알았습니다.

http://caniuse.com/xhr2

https://github.com/malsup/form/issues/177

관련 문제